Find the x-intercept and y-intercept from the following linear equation: 9x - 3y = -81

Answer:

The x-intercept is (-9,0). The y-intercept is (0,27).

Step-by-step explanation:

9x - 3y = -81

-9x         -9x                  Subtract 9x from both sides

-3y = -9x - 81                Divide both sides by -3

y = 3x + 27
